Images that I have seen show the trees spread throughout the gorge. The largest tree is estimated to be 1000 years old and has 100 trunks. They are growing in what is essentially leaf litter over sandstone in a deep gorge. Some seedlings have even been found growing out of crevices in the sandstone on the side of the gorge. The Wollemi Pine is a born survivor.
